Understanding the core concept of forex sentiment
Forex sentiment refers to market participants' views and judgments on a specific currency pair. Market psychology is driven by various factors, including economic data releases, geopolitical events, news trends, and overall market trends. However, market participants play a crucial role in determining market direction.
Generally speaking, forex market sentiment can be quantified using various tools and indicators, with the most popular being specialized sentiment indicators. These indicators provide a window into market psychology, such as the percentage of bullish or bearish traders.
